Transaction efd3780e006a9b86354257af112376d7df467302eda536811806dd46fd863075
1 Input
1 Output
-
efd3780e006a9b86354257af112376d7df467302eda536811806dd46fd863075:0
- value
- 170036593
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3e0ebab6a9f14eeec83849cf289433070826b38
- address
- bc1qu0swh2m2nu2wamyrsjw09z2rxpcgy6ec63q7er